Line segments form the foundation of geometric understanding for kindergarten students, and Wayground's comprehensive collection of line segment worksheets provides young learners with engaging, age-appropriate practice materials. These carefully crafted worksheets introduce kindergarteners to the fundamental concept that a line segment is a straight path between two endpoints, helping students develop spatial reasoning and visual discrimination skills essential for future mathematical success. Each worksheet includes clear answer keys for educators and offers free printable resources that transform abstract geometric concepts into concrete learning experiences through tracing activities, identification exercises, and hands-on practice problems that build recognition of straight lines versus curves.
